The proliferation of agentic coding has significantly escalated the complexity of a software engineer's daily work. Modern engineers may find themselves managing dozens of coding agents concurrently, initiating and directing various processes as required. This intricate oversight demands considerable attention, quickly rendering human engineers' focus the primary limiting factor in productivity.
To address this burgeoning complexity, Cursor is introducing a new solution today called Automations. This innovative system empowers users to automatically launch agents within their coding environment. These launches can be triggered by events such as new additions to the codebase, incoming Slack messages, or predefined timers. Cursor positions Automations as a sophisticated method to review and maintain the extensive code generated by agentic tools, eliminating the need for engineers to manually track numerous agents simultaneously.
Fundamentally, Automations enable engineers to transcend the conventional "prompt-and-monitor" paradigm that characterizes much of agent-based engineering. Rather than requiring a human to manually prompt agents for every task, Cursor's Automation framework facilitates autonomous agent activation, ensuring human involvement is strategically integrated only when essential.
"It's not that humans are completely out of the picture," Jonas Nelle, one of Cursor's engineering chiefs for asynchronous agents, clarified to TechCrunch. "It's that they aren't always initiating. They're called in at the right points in this conveyor belt."
A precursor to this broader Automation system is Bugbot, a long-standing Cursor feature. Bugbot activates each time an engineer commits new code to the codebase, meticulously reviewing it for bugs and other potential issues. By leveraging Automations, Cursor has successfully enhanced this system, extending its capabilities to encompass more thorough security audits and comprehensive review processes.
Engineering lead Josh Ma remarked, "This idea of thinking harder, spending more tokens to find harder issues, has been really valuable."
Cursor estimates that its platform currently executes hundreds of automations per hour, extending far beyond routine code review. The system also plays a crucial role in incident response, where PagerDuty incidents can trigger an agent to instantly query server logs via an MCP connection. Furthermore, a separate automation provides weekly summaries of codebase changes directly to Cursor's company Slack channel.
"In the abstract, anything that an automation kicks off, a human could have also kicked off," Nelle explained. "But by making it automatic, you change the types of tasks that models can usefully do in a code base."
This launch occurs amidst an intensely competitive landscape within the agentic coding sector. Both OpenAI and Anthropic have unveiled significant updates to their respective agentic coding tools in the past month, intensifying the race for innovation.
Despite the competitive environment, data from Ramp indicates that Cursor's market share has remained stable since May, with approximately 25% of generative AI clients subscribing to Cursor in some capacity.
Nonetheless, the overall expansion of the agentic coding space has fueled a remarkable surge in Cursor's revenue. Bloomberg reported earlier this week that Cursor's annual revenue has soared to over $2 billion, effectively doubling within the last three months alone.
